μολὼν λαβέ

This phrase was reportedly the defiant response of King Leonidas I of Sparta to Xerxes I of Persia when Xerxes demanded that the Greeks lay down their arms and surrender prior to the Battle of Thermopylae in 480 BC.

"Molon Llabe"

A true translation is "come and take".

An equivalent modern day phrase is "Bring It".
